Doors & Windows Northborough, MA and near me (5)

Window World of Boston

1000 Boston Turnpike
Shrewsbury , 01545
(508) 845-6676
Yext Logo
Doors & Windows Shrewsbury

Renewal by Andersen of Boston

30 Forbes Road
Northborough , 01532
(508) 351-9292
Yext Logo
Doors & Windows Northborough
44 Bearfoot Road
Northborough , 01532
(855) 229-8297
Roof Contractors Northborough
(0)
122 Hudson Street
Northborough , 01532
(508) 726-4198
Residential Contractors Northborough
(0)